The United States railway industry relies heavily on various technological advancements to improve efficiency and safety. In this context, cyber security solutions have become crucial in protecting the intricate systems that manage railway operations. One of the key applications of cyber security solutions in the railway sector is in the management of signaling systems. These systems are responsible for ensuring safe and efficient train movements by communicating signals between trains and control centers. Cyber attacks targeting these systems can lead to significant safety hazards and operational disruptions. Therefore, robust cyber security measures are implemented to safeguard signaling systems from potential threats, ensuring the reliability and integrity of train operations.
Another critical application of cyber security solutions in the railway sector is in the protection of train control systems. These systems are responsible for managing train speeds, braking, and other essential functions. Given the high-stakes nature of train control, any compromise to these systems could have disastrous consequences. Cyber security solutions are designed to protect these systems from unauthorized access and malicious attacks, ensuring that trains operate safely and efficiently. Implementing advanced security protocols and monitoring tools helps in detecting and mitigating potential threats, thereby enhancing the overall safety of the railway network.

Passenger information systems are also a significant area where cyber security solutions are applied. These systems provide real-time information to passengers regarding train schedules, delays, and other important updates. As these systems become increasingly digital and interconnected, they are vulnerable to cyber threats that could disrupt service or mislead passengers. To mitigate these risks, cyber security measures are deployed to protect the integrity and confidentiality of the information provided. This includes implementing encryption technologies and secure access controls to prevent unauthorized interference and ensure the accuracy and reliability of passenger information.
Additionally, cyber security solutions play a crucial role in protecting railway operational technology, which includes various automated systems used for monitoring and controlling railway infrastructure. This technology is essential for maintaining the smooth operation of railway services, from track maintenance to station management. Given the potential impact of cyber attacks on these systems, comprehensive security strategies are necessary to safeguard against vulnerabilities. By employing advanced threat detection and response mechanisms, railway operators can prevent unauthorized access and ensure the continuous functionality of operational technology.
Lastly, the application of cyber security solutions extends to the protection of communication networks used within the railway sector. These networks facilitate crucial data exchange between various railway systems, including train management, maintenance operations, and emergency response units. Cyber threats targeting these communication networks can disrupt operations and pose significant risks. To address these challenges, robust security measures are implemented to protect against eavesdropping, data breaches, and network disruptions. Ensuring the security of communication networks is vital for maintaining the overall integrity and efficiency of the railway system.
